Cleveland, OH, July 2006 --- This year, the 2006 Ernst & Young Entrepreneur of the Year awards honor Al Haire, CEO of Enerco Group Inc., a leading manufacturer of gas-fired heating products for consumer, commercial and industrial applications.
In 1984, when working as a sales rep for a small manufacturer of overhead heaters, Mr. Haire leveraged everything he had to buy the company. With a belief in the honor of hard work, a strong mentor and a thoughtful growth strategy, Haire lead that small company into the successful EGI, a global manufacturer with 100 employees.
Al Haire and his team began EGI with a business strategy that seemed risky: to maintain the two-step distribution channel while opening up a new channel reaching the retail market. To meet this challenge, he guided the further marketing and development of a tank top heater line that would meet the needs of retail customers who worked and played in the cold --- dockworkers, tradesmen, campers, and outdoorsmen.
Through product development, repackaging, and a sales strategy that targeted both large and small retailers, EGI’s portable heater product line catapulted the company into the retail market.
Ace Hardware was their first large customer; today, EGI products are found in Wal-Mart, Tractor Supply and Lowe’s stores as well as in smaller independent retailers. Northern Tool and Cabela’s catalogs sell their specialty products for the construction and outdoor markets.
One significant obstacle faced by EGI was the tragic fact that consumers were improperly using the portable heaters inside, putting them at risk for carbon monoxide poisoning. To respond to this issue, the company developed the Buddy line of portable heaters, whose technology features an oxygen depletion shut-off (ODS), making them indoor safe.
With the launch of the Buddy line, EGI experienced a phase of phenomenal growth. Product demand outstripped their old facility on East 79th Street in Cleveland, so in 2002, EGI moved their headquarters to its present location on West 160th Street. 125,000 square feet of office, manufacturing and warehouse space has allowed the company to grow more efficiently. EGI has shown about 35 percent growth for each of the past few years
The Ernst & Young Entrepreneur of the Year Award honors owners and managers of both public and private companies who are primarily responsible for its recent performance. An independent panel of judges made up of past award recipients and successful business leaders assess the financial performance, company growth, leadership, profitability, strategic direction, innovation, personal integrity, values and originality of each nominee and company.
